Skool Cost Information
For a fixed monthly fee of $99, Skool opens the entrance to a riches of attributes created to encourage creators in the digital world. This straightforward pricing model liberates creators from the details of tiered plans, enabling them to concentrate completely on content development and community interaction.
Develop a committed space for your community within Skool, tailored to the specific passions of your target market, whether it’s a particular niche group or a broader community.
Open the whole of Skool’s feature-rich platform with the $99 plan. From course development tools to community interaction features and subscription management, creators access the complete collection without surprise costs or added costs.
Break without limitations and explore the complete spectrum of content production. Skool’s pricing plan makes it possible for creators to offer an unrestricted number of courses, fostering versatility and fitting varied content brochures.
Cultivate a flourishing community without constraints. Skool’s pricing plan allows creators to invite and engage a limitless variety of members, developing a vibrant and extensive online presence.
To sustain the smooth deal procedure within Skool, a moderate 2.9% deal fee is used. This fee contributes to the continual renovation and upkeep of the platform, making sure creators can concentrate on their core priorities creating content and connecting with their audience.
